fix(dom) Loader: this -> Loader

This commit is contained in:
coderaiser 2013-10-02 13:27:20 +00:00
parent b973e2541a
commit 4646997262

View file

@ -730,8 +730,6 @@ var CloudCmd, Util, DOM, CloudFunc;
* @param pFunc - onload function
*/
this.anyLoadOnLoad = function(pParams_a, pFunc) {
var lRet = this;
if ( Util.isArray(pParams_a) ) {
var lParam = pParams_a.pop(),
lFunc = function() {
@ -742,19 +740,19 @@ var CloudCmd, Util, DOM, CloudFunc;
lParam = { src : lParam };
else if ( Util.isArray(lParam) ) {
this.anyLoadInParallel(lParam, lFunc);
Loader.anyLoadInParallel(lParam, lFunc);
}
if (lParam && !lParam.func) {
lParam.func = lFunc;
this.anyload(lParam);
Loader.anyload(lParam);
}else
Util.exec(pFunc);
}
return lRet;
return Loader;
};
/**
@ -766,8 +764,7 @@ var CloudCmd, Util, DOM, CloudFunc;
* @param pFunc - onload function
*/
this.anyLoadInParallel = function(pParams_a, pFunc) {
var lRet = this,
lDone = [],
var lDone = [],
lDoneFunc = function (pCallBack) {
Util.exec(pCallBack);
@ -792,11 +789,11 @@ var CloudCmd, Util, DOM, CloudFunc;
var lFunc = lParam.func;
lParam.func = Util.retExec(lDoneFunc, lFunc);
this.anyload(lParam);
Loader.anyload(lParam);
}
}
return lRet;
return Loader;
};
/**
@ -853,7 +850,7 @@ var CloudCmd, Util, DOM, CloudFunc;
}
/* убираем путь к файлу, оставляя только название файла */
if (!lID && lSrc)
lID = this.getIdBySrc(lSrc);
lID = DOM.getIdBySrc(lSrc);
var lElement = DOMTree.getById(lID);
@ -953,7 +950,7 @@ var CloudCmd, Util, DOM, CloudFunc;
* @param pFunc
*/
this.jsload = function(pSrc, pFunc) {
var lRet = this.anyload({
var lRet = Loader.anyload({
name : 'script',
src : pSrc,
func : pFunc
@ -984,7 +981,7 @@ var CloudCmd, Util, DOM, CloudFunc;
pParams_o.name = 'style';
pParams_o.parent = pParams_o.parent || document.head;
return this.anyload(pParams_o);
return Loader.anyload(pParams_o);
},
/**
@ -1000,7 +997,7 @@ var CloudCmd, Util, DOM, CloudFunc;
pParams_o[i].parent = pParams_o.parent || document.head;
}
return this.anyload(pParams_o);
return Loader.anyload(pParams_o);
}
else if ( Util.isString(pParams_o) )
@ -1009,7 +1006,7 @@ var CloudCmd, Util, DOM, CloudFunc;
pParams_o.name = 'link';
pParams_o.parent = pParams_o.parent || document.head;
return this.anyload(pParams_o);
return Loader.anyload(pParams_o);
};
/**